Data Scientist, Manchester (Office & Home Working)

Permanent
Full-Time
Hybrid office and home
Salary circa £40,000 to £52,000 plus Bonus Plan


INRIX is a global leader in the transport and traffic intelligence sector. Our aim is to provide usable, reliable information on human movement to make cities smarter, safer and more desirable. We help to power some of the largest companies and organisations in the world, and are looking for a curious, driven, data scientist to help us.

Our data science team works within a squad model, collaborating with engineers across functions and time zones to take projects from prototype to production. We use Databricks as our core platform and are looking to extend that adoption across other teams, there is scope to influence our data strategy if that interests you.

Help deliver the next generation of traffic insight tools and solutions from our team in Altrincham, Manchester, right at the heart of the company's most innovative products. Develop your career using the latest statistical and machine learning techniques to build enterprise-ready solutions in a supportive, motivated team.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op innovative algorithms and machine learning models that add value to our data.
  • Process and analyse large-scale mobility datasets describing the movement of populations.
  • Build and maintain the data pipelines behind your own models within Databricks, from raw ingestion through transformation to production.
  • Be self-led in your research of ml models and algorithms to solve interesting and non-standard problems.
  • Design impactful data visualizations and insights to communicate your work with stakeholders, both expert and non-technical, across the business.
  • Pioneer the use of emerging data science and machine learning techniques and technologies to ensure best practice within the business.

What We Are Looking For:

Required:

  • A creative and inquiring mind with considerable problem-solving ability.
  • An excellent grasp of advanced mathematic concepts related to DS (e.g. Linear Algebra, Statistics).
  • Experience building ML that has been tested in a real-world setting (production/research).
  • The ability to work effectively in a team, take and give advice where necessary.
  • An advanced degree in a subject with significant statistical or mathematical content or demonstrable technical strength through experience.
  • Demonstrable experience in scientific computing (Python preferred).
  • Proficiency in SQL and/or PySpark.

Highly Desirable:

  • An excellent grasp of DS concepts with emphasis on modern ML techniques.
  • Experience building and maintaining production data pipelines, ideally hands-on with Databricks (Delta Lake, Workflows, Unity Catalog) or a similar Spark-based lakehouse platform.
  • Familiarity with MLflow or similar tooling for experiment tracking and model deployment.
  • Experience accessing and processing structured and unstructured data in AWS.
  • Exceptionally good written and verbal presentation skills.
  • Understanding of how to create effective visualisations from data.

Desirable:

  • Experience with traffic or mobility data.
